Vinyl LP pressing. Louisiana-bred southern songwriter Rod Gator takes a hard look at his old stomping grounds with For Louisiana. It's an album rooted in Bayou soul, greasy country-rock, Texas blues, and electrified funk, created by a team that includes Grammyr-nominated producer Adrian Quesada and keyboardist JaRon Marshall of the Black Pumas. Laced with Muscle Shoals-worthy grooves and Gator's unique blend of spoken-word delivery and southern crooning, For Louisiana isn't just a love letter to Louisiana - it's also a rallying cry for cultural progress, with songs that examine the state's struggles with social justice and political reform.
